MySQL 基础语法教程

本教程将带您了解 MySQL 数据库的基础语法,涵盖创建数据库、创建表、插入数据、更新数据、删除数据、查询数据、排序数据、分组数据、连接数据表、聚合函数和子查询等关键操作。

1. 创建数据库

CREATE DATABASE database_name;

2. 删除数据库

DROP DATABASE database_name;

3. 选择数据库

USE database_name;

4. 创建表

CREATE TABLE table_name (
column1 datatype,
column2 datatype,
column3 datatype,
...
);

5. 删除表

DROP TABLE table_name;

6. 修改表

ALTER TABLE table_name
ADD column_name datatype;

7. 插入数据

INSERT INTO table_name (column1, column2, column3, ...)
VALUES (value1, value2, value3, ...);

8. 更新数据

UPDATE table_name
SET column_name = new_value
WHERE condition;

9. 删除数据

DELETE FROM table_name
WHERE condition;

10. 查询数据

SELECT column1, column2, ...
FROM table_name
WHERE condition;

11. 排序数据

SELECT column1, column2, ...
FROM table_name
ORDER BY column_name ASC/DESC;

12. 分组数据

SELECT column_name, COUNT(*)
FROM table_name
GROUP BY column_name;

13. 连接数据表

SELECT column_name
FROM table1
LEFT JOIN table2
ON table1.column_name = table2.column_name;

14. 聚合函数

SELECT COUNT(*)
FROM table_name;

15. 子查询

SELECT column_name
FROM table_name
WHERE column_name IN (SELECT column_name FROM table_name WHERE condition);

注意:

  • 以上代码中的 database_name, table_name, column_name, datatype, value, condition 等需要根据实际情况进行替换。
  • ASC 表示升序排序,DESC 表示降序排序。
  • LEFT JOIN 是左连接,还有其他连接方式,例如 INNER JOINRIGHT JOIN
  • 聚合函数除了 COUNT(*) 外,还有 SUM(), AVG(), MAX(), MIN() 等。
  • 子查询可以嵌套在其他查询语句中。

希望本教程能帮助您更好地理解 MySQL 基础语法。如果您有任何问题,请随时留言。

MySQL 基础语法教程:从创建数据库到数据查询

原文地址: https://www.cveoy.top/t/topic/mSwv 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录